@namespace url(http://www.w3.org/1999/xhtml);

@-moz-document url("http://userstyles.org/"), 
               url-prefix("http://userstyles.org/user/"), 
               url-prefix("http://userstyles.org/users/"), 
               url-prefix("http://userstyles.org/style/"), 
               url-prefix("http://userstyles.org/styles/"), 
               url-prefix("http://userstyles.org/styles;"), 
               url-prefix("http://userstyles.org/stylish"),
               url-prefix("http://userstyles.org/livetitle") , url("https://userstyles.org/"), url-prefix("https://userstyles.org/user/"), url-prefix("https://userstyles.org/users/"), url-prefix("https://userstyles.org/style/"), url-prefix("https://userstyles.org/styles/"), url-prefix("https://userstyles.org/styles;"), url-prefix("https://userstyles.org/stylish"), url-prefix("https://userstyles.org/livetitle") {

* {font-family:sans-serif !important;}

#sidebar > ul {                       
   -moz-column-count: 2 !important;
   font-size: 15px !important;        
   margin-bottom: 10px !important; 
   }

#style-list {
    -moz-column-count: 3 !important;
    font-size: small; /*optional*/
  }

html body h1 { background: none !important; }

div[id='other-links']
{
  position: absolute !important;
  top: 40px !important;
  right: 145px !important;
}

html { background: #a5998a !important; }

body {
  color: #333 !important;
  background: #dfdcca url("data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AABAAAADbCAMAAABTAuEkAAAABGdBTUEAAK%2FINwWK6QAAABl0RVh0U29mdHdhcmUAQWRvYmUgSW1hZ2VSZWFkeXHJZTwAAABgUExURebj0fbz4Ozp1%2Fr35PTx3uPgzvLu3O7r2Orn1ejl0%2Fv45f776fj14ufk0v355%2Ff04vPw3fDt2%2F%2F86eDdy%2BHezOLfzeThz%2F365%2Fn24%2Bvo1uXi0PHu2%2Bnm1O%2Fs2u3q1%2FXy4ExqRg0AAACESURBVHja7MjJDoJAEEXRdgRxBBVn%2Ff%2B%2FdO2tTaXzGmJSZ3lSBykiIiJCFmtwxAUGih3YaKBMzMDGFSSxAUfswRETKBMfSHOQxAFyYgk2HiCJFhzxAhsVSOINkpiCjRvkRA2OeIIkViCJLeREEXeQRA9jxQIGijOMFSf4ozhCxK%2BvAAMAqtDkgYl7OkgAAAAASUVORK5CYII%3D") 0 0 repeat-x !important;
  border: 4px solid grey !important;
  -moz-border-radius-bottomleft: 9px !important;
  -moz-border-radius-bottomright: 9px !important;
  border-top: none !important;
  border-bottom: 4px solid grey !important;
  margin: 0 8% !important;
  padding-right: 1% !important;
  padding-left: 1% !important;
  padding-bottom: 2% !important;
}

div[id='install'] 
{ 
  background: #DDFFBB !important; 
  border: 2px solid grey !important;
  width: 370px !important;
}

div[id='breadcrumbs'] a { display: none !important; }

#logo a { color: #fff !important; }

pre { border: 1px solid #afac9a !important; }

#header-bar {
  background: #426395 !important;
  border: 2px solid #7e94a6 !important;
  border-top: none !important;
}

#navigation a, #navigation a:visited, #navigation .current-page {
  border: 1px solid #5e82b8 !important;
  background: #6483b3 !important;
  color: #f0f0f0 !important;
  text-decoration: none !important;
  -moz-border-radius: 8px 8px 0 0 !important;
}

#navigation a:hover {
  color: #fff !important;
  text-decoration: underline !important;
}

#navigation .current-page { 
  background: #7392c1 !important; 
  color: #f9e917 !important;
  text-decoration: none !important;
}

a:link, #sidebar h2 a { color: #26457d !important; }
a:visited { color: #7f7d73 !important; }
li a:hover { background: #e7e4d1 !important; }
#account-link a { color: #fff !important; }

#search-terms {
  background-color: #fff !important;
  border: 1px solid #6382b1 !important;
}

#search input[type="submit"] {
  border: 1px solid #82a5da !important;
  background-color: #7392c1 !important;
  color: #fff !important;
}

/* no google ads (sorry, np, but it doesn't display properly since I'm styling the html tag or something) */
iframe { visibility: hidden !important; }


li a { line-height: 1.3 !important; }

img[src$="star_0.png"] {
  width: 0 !important;
  height: 20px !important;
  padding-left: 17px !important;
  background: url("data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AABEAAAAUCAYAAABroNZJAAAABGdBTUEAAK%2FINwWK6QAAABl0RVh0U29mdHdhcmUAQWRvYmUgSW1hZ2VSZWFkeXHJZTwAAAKKSURBVHjatJTbT9NgGMafdh0MxgrbgKFRyRK5UYOSKB447IuiMcIdNyIaD4n%2FkfFObwzZjUhiwEQxWGEqYDAkgHNsJAp0Qw5jdOsOdAffTkUUiIrxa9rmS9%2Fv1%2Bd73qflcrkc%2FnXwvyuYnBhn8bjKdg2JRFaZ230fMwHf7pWMjngQXgmiv793dxBVjTHP0HO4XC7MfvTC55tifw0ZGfbAaOTgqLJCtHDo6%2B3eUYmweZJOp1k0uobV1TBeDPShqfkMPoem86BA4D1eSv3s0OFaWCwiTKYi6fs6bvjNICOpUBR98TKBNAgGDgdralBZacaM%2Fx0EwYhwOIpQSEFRsZXmhRBLrSil0%2BHYA0FVVTzpe4hjR4%2Bgen8VTEUFVMTRVjTyYgo8b4AeJbtdhCgWQ1vPIZVcR2Q5gLcjc2hmbeD0sHmGBpi76y6c1XZYbWbk6Mhms3kAx%2F2wjePoQsB4LAnftIzjpy6g8%2Brtr540Np2VeJ5nXQ%2FuUCUIZIHBYNjWxCSp%2BDA9j9ONbei4cotexEvc5ti%2FfiWxnu57cDrLyDgTtvsk%2FKSgtq4Flztu5gFbWnyivgH28n3QtG%2FSNw19ntbSSCRzcLHzG4AtkEgkjFhMQVlpOTJaRt8ZeFqt37MZciqje5KBPD%2B3c04UJYJEQiGyHQk1hbVoHGtKHMXUMZtVRIEg0LMsZHmWqhu2T%2BxCKEgKEgjKC%2FDS3iFU4GLrdew9UAf%2FzCLm5SUYyXBZ%2FrSzEq93AotLK7CVV%2BPajU7Un2zUuySda7mkP2PPnj7G2Ogg0rwfqVSSFRaa8r5sdEePfM8jN0pKLGh2tcBsLpF%2B7Qxlh42NDWNqchytbe2oqHD8DPmvf7Y%2FGV8EGAAoiw5jzzI77QAAAABJRU5ErkJggg%3D%3D") 0 0 no-repeat !important;
}

img[src$="star_05.png"] {
  width: 0 !important;
  height: 20px !important;
  padding-left: 17px !important;
  background: url("data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AABEAAAAUCAYAAABroNZJAAAABGdBTUEAAK%2FINwWK6QAAABl0RVh0U29mdHdhcmUAQWRvYmUgSW1hZ2VSZWFkeXHJZTwAAAIhSURBVHjatJTPTxNREMe%2Fb3e79oclbVLhIMREQSq6WgJpTTAGDsrFxMiBeOTg2YT4Z3jmwoUDJw96tYmKGhJSpdTYShGNArW0QVsD3bbb0u4b36okJlRba5xk3%2B7mzXzyfTPzhhER%2FtWkZg4f3y%2B9rVT0ubYhxWKOHoXvYjv1un0lyXgYqCUQfTHfHqRiFGgtfg%2BXR0exv%2FsMqc3o1F9DVhNhuF1V9PoVDPSmEVmcbU2JadZIL%2BxQJp2gNytzCF4KQa4tou%2BsDG48xqvog%2F5GEGU1%2FpCEVBjlPEp6BkQV2NU6tAun0XUsi3opDafTgVBQRyw2jcHhicMQUT7EIjO4OHwKWsAHt1eCy83gcq6hbiQBpoJzhp5uGV2dRsPjKEPBSWazHaHlhWmc7HwHn5uDZEK9zAXAJlzk745c%2FNrUxilUrOX84HXGmExPF25jzF7A8RMimLXescrBhxa4ZoVRdPkOvL4cXEdVEP%2FlSohdMluozplzV0FqAHu7TkiM%2F1Dz87Fe1RJvDinqX1A18qI63TBFADMJksUSCsyyyEuJ%2Ffk4lpWKOUHNwiXWQsZEds9E5rMEbwdHj0%2BBo1lOLMvntmCXckh9kBFbF1ueMfi1G8h8WkEych99nq8YGWkC2dp4ie0dHQbGEbhyCwPaOCRJ8SN0E5sbk1PRpcYTgR0MJavlnz%2BZEd3pQWBoAnZHx6EEEPF%2BxqT130L%2B62Rrxb4JMADbQNVrB0%2Bz0QAAAABJRU5ErkJggg%3D%3D") 0 0 no-repeat !important;
}

.errorExplanation {
  background-color: #900 !important; 
  color: #fff !important; 
  -moz-border-radius: .5em !important;
  padding: .5em !important;
  margin: .5em 0 !important;
}
.errorExplanation h2 { color: #FFC !important; }


/* LiveTitles
---------------*/

#page {
  background: #dfdcca url("data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AABAAAADbCAMAAABTAuEkAAAABGdBTUEAAK%2FINwWK6QAAABl0RVh0U29mdHdhcmUAQWRvYmUgSW1hZ2VSZWFkeXHJZTwAAABgUExURebj0fbz4Ozp1%2Fr35PTx3uPgzvLu3O7r2Orn1ejl0%2Fv45f776fj14ufk0v355%2Ff04vPw3fDt2%2F%2F86eDdy%2BHezOLfzeThz%2F365%2Fn24%2Bvo1uXi0PHu2%2Bnm1O%2Fs2u3q1%2FXy4ExqRg0AAACESURBVHja7MjJDoJAEEXRdgRxBBVn%2Ff%2B%2FdO2tTaXzGmJSZ3lSBykiIiJCFmtwxAUGih3YaKBMzMDGFSSxAUfswRETKBMfSHOQxAFyYgk2HiCJFhzxAhsVSOINkpiCjRvkRA2OeIIkViCJLeREEXeQRA9jxQIGijOMFSf4ozhCxK%2BvAAMAqtDkgYl7OkgAAAAASUVORK5CYII%3D") 0 0 repeat-x !important;
  margin-top: 0 !important;
}

textarea { background-color: #fff !important; }

/** Header **/
#breadcrumbs {margin:0 !important; padding: 5px !important; background-color:#426395 !important; height:56px !important; -moz-border-radius:0px 0px 10px 10px !important; border-top:0 none !important; text-align:right !important; font-size:0 !important; padding-right:21px !important; background:url(http://img219.imageshack.us/img219/2298/23237376.gif) #426395 no-repeat 23px 21px !important;}
#breadcrumbs a {font-size:16px !important; line-height:94px !important; background-color:#7392C1 !important; color:white !important; text-decoration:none !important; font-weight:bold !important; padding:2px 10px 4px !important; -moz-border-radius:5px 5px 0px 0px !important; margin-left:4px !important;}
#breadcrumbs a:hover {background-color:#83A2D1 !important;}
#breadcrumbs a[href="/"] {position:absolute !important; background:none !important; top:14px !important; left:37px !important; line-height:32px !important; font-size:0px !important;}
#breadcrumbs a[href="/"]:after {content:"userstyles.org" !important; line-height:32px !important; font-size:32px !important;}
#other-links a {color:white !important;}
#other-links input#search-terms {background:#DDDDDD !important; border:1px solid #7E94A6 !important; padding-left:2px !important; padding-right:2px !important; width:15em !important; -moz-appearance:none !important; -moz-border-radius:5px !important; font-size:-moz-use-system-font !important;}
#other-links input#search-submit {background:#7392C1 !important; color:white !important; -moz-appearance:none !important; border:1px solid #4444AA !important; font-weight:bold !important; -moz-border-radius:5px !important; font-size:-moz-use-system-font !important;}

h1 {margin:0.67em 0 !important; margin-bottom: 0 !important; padding: 0 !important; background:white !important; font-variant:normal !important;}

}